Logo Studenta

GUIA 7 SISTEMAS DE INFORMACION

¡Este material tiene más páginas!

Vista previa del material en texto

SISTEMAS DE INFORMACION 
DESARROLLO 
 
 
7. Conceptos generales. 
Un sistema de información es un conjunto de elementos interrelacionados, están 
conformados por elementos de entrada que son procesados para obtener como 
resultado información eficaz y oportuna. Los sistemas de información cambian de rol 
de acuerdo a la función en específica que cumplen. 
Unos de los objetivos de todos sistema de información el del almacena, gestión y la 
utilización de datos, que una vez procesados se convierten en información. El 
propósito básico de cualquier sistema de información es ayudar a sus usuarios a 
obtener cierto tipo de valor de la información que está en el sistema, sin importar el 
tipo de información que se almacena o el tipo de valor deseado. (peter, 2005) 
 
 
 
 
7.1 tipos de sistemas de información 
 
teniendo en cuenta al aumento o globalización de los sistemas de información y de 
las demandas empresariales lo podemos comparar con el auge de las 
funcionalidades de los mismos, esta características también ayudan a tipificarlos, es 
decir a nombrar los distintos tipos de sistemas de información los cuales son 
 
 sistemas de automatización de oficinas 
 
Utiliza ordenadores o redes informáticas para el procesamiento de la 
información como son el procesamiento de textos, contabilidad, administración 
de documentos de documentos o comunicaciones. Los sistemas de 
automatización de oficinas están diseñados para manejar información y (lo que 
es aún más importante) para ayudar a los usuarios a controlar ciertas tareas 
relacionadas con información en una forma más eficiente. En las organizaciones 
grandes, las tareas simples como el programa de un proyecto, conservación de 
registros y correspondencia pueden consumir demasiado tiempo y trabajo 
humano. Sin embargo, mediante el uso de herramientas de auto­matización de 
oficinas, los trabajadores de todos los niveles pueden emplear menos tiempo y 
esfuerzo en las tareas cotidianas, lo cual les deja tiempo libre para realizar 
trabajos más importantes como la planeación, diseño y ventas. Por esta razón, 
prácticamente cualquier sistema de información completo cuenta con un 
componente de automatización de oficinas. (peter, 2005) 
 
 
 
 
 
 Sistemas de procesamiento de transacciones 
 
Es un sistema que controla el procesamiento y seguimiento de las transacción, 
un transacción consiste en solicitar un producto ya previamente comercializado 
por internet u otro medio virtual, donde se registra toda la información 
personal(nombre, servicio, dirección, número de tarjeta de crédito )sobre un 
usuario que necesita un servicio 
 
 
 
 Sistemas de administración de información 
 
Son un conjunto de elementos que se encargan de gestionar la información de 
cierta entidad, es decir, capturar, ordenar, modificar y evaluar la información 
 
Los sistemas de administración de información tienes distintas gestiones 
 
 Gestión ejecutiva 
 Gestión media 
 Gestión de campo 
 
 La eficiencia estos sistemas radica en el resumen de una gran cantidad de 
 Datos de una empresa 
 
 Sistemas de apoyo a la toma de decisiones 
 
Son sistemas de gran utilidad ya que ofrecen a la gestión datos altamente 
diseñados y estructurados sobre una función en específico. 
 
Algunos de ellos pueden ser hojas de cálculo o base de datos. Se pueden 
generar resultados basados en datos existen, estos resultados también pueden 
ser actualizados de manera momentánea e instantánea 
 
 Sistemas expertos 
 
 
Estos sistemas realizan actividades que por lo general son realizadas por los 
seres humanos, ellos requieren de la gran experiencia humana sobre una tarea 
en específico, las base datos son de gran importancia hay se encuentra 
contenida la gran información, estas base de datos son llamadas bases del 
conocimiento, un ejemplo de los sistemas experto es : 
 
 “un sistema de diagnosis puede revisar los síntomas y el historial médico de un 
paciente y entonces sugerir un diagnóstico y los tratamientos posibles. Luego, 
un d o c to r puede considerar las recomendaciones del sistema antes de tratar 
al paciente. De hecho, un sistema experto llamado Mycin fue desarrollado p o r 
Stanford University' en los años setenta con el fin de diagnostica r y recomendar 
tratamientos para infecciones de la sangre específicas. Sólo se utilizó de forma 
experimenta l, debido a los aspectos éticos y legales que en ese tiempo se 
relacionaban con el uso de las computadoras en la medicina. No obstante, 
representó un paso importante en el diseño y aceptación eventual de los 
sistemas experto s comerciales” (peter, 2005) 
 
 
 
 
 
 
 
 
 
 
7.2 Tipos de modelos de ciclos de vida de sistemas 
Los modelos de ciclo de vida de sistemas son un conjunto de actividades que se 
llevan a cabo para la realización de un sistema, es un proceso formado por las etapas 
de análisis, diseño e implementación. 
Para el desarrollo de un sistema se definen las siguientes etapas: 
 
A. investigación preliminar: se revisan las peticiones por parte del 
administrador, es una reunión entre los actores del sistema(administrador, 
empleado o especialista en sistema ), consta de tres actividades: 
 
 
 se aclara la solicitud: se analizan las solicitudes de los empleados y usuarios, 
muchas veces estas solicitudes no está claras dentro de lo que se pretenden 
con el sistema por lo tanto debe examinarse para obtener lo que se pretende 
 se hacen estudios de factibilidad: se determina si el sistema es factible y para 
ellos se tiene en cuenta tres factibilidad: 
 
 factibilidad técnica: se estudia que tipo de tecnología se necesitan para la 
ejecución del proyecto y que posibilidades nos brinda. 
 Factibilidad económica: se estudian los beneficios del sistema y se 
comparan con los costos del sistema 
 Factibilidad operacional: una vez se desarrolló el sistema se estudia si 
cumple con las expectativas funcionales, como será utilizado, como se 
adaptara a las peticiones del usuario y los beneficios de la aplicación 
 
 se aprueban la solicitud con el cliente: una vez hecho las etapas anteriores se 
consolidan o se plasma los acuerdos para la realización de los contratos 
 
 
B. determinación de los requerimientos del sistema 
en esta etapa se determinan los requisitos funcionales y no funcionales del 
sistema 
C. diseño del sistema 
Se diseña el sistema de información de acuerdo a los requerimientos estudiados 
en la etapa de análisis, se llama también diseño lógico o diseño físico. En el 
diseño de un sistema se identifican los datos de entrada para ser calculados y 
almacenados en el sistema, estos datos con calculados en procesos lógicos, se 
selecciona las estructura de los archivos y los dispositivos de almacenamiento. 
Los diseñadores son los responsables del desarrollo del sistema, en el diseños se 
plantean las características completas del sistema 
D. desarrollo del software 
para el desarrollo del software se necesita un software instalado o IDE (entorno 
de desarrollo integrado) que es un programa de aplicación la etapa de desarrollo 
es la etapa responsable de la documentación del sistema y la codificación del 
software 
E. prueba de los sistemas 
el sistema se ejecuta de manera experimental para determinar su funcionamiento 
y que no tenga errores, su funcionamiento debe estar de acuerdo a sus 
requerimiento 
F. implantación y evaluación 
es el proceso de verificación e instalación en nuevo ordenador o dispositivo, 
adecuan todos los archivos para la ejecución del software para determinar si mi 
software es compatible con la arquitectura de mi dispositivo 
 
 
 
 
 
 
 
 
 
7.3 La ingeniería de software y su aplicación en la calidad 
 
La ingeniería de software es una disciplina que se encarga de los aspecto de la 
producción de software, la ingeniería de software determina enfoque sistemático para 
llevar a cabo su trabajo utilizando herramientas y técnicas apropiadas para resolverlos 
problemas cotidiano, todas las actividades cotidianas puedes ser reemplazadas por un 
software siempre y cuando tengan un orden lógico, teniendo en cuenta prácticas de 
desarrollo que son útiles para la producción de software 
7.4 Técnicas actuales. 
El desarrollo del software debe cumplir una serie de etapas para su calidad, la calidad es 
una aplicación práctica del conocimiento científico al diseño y construcción de programas 
de computadoras y la documentación asociada requerida para desarrollar 
Las técnicas del desarrollo del software son las siguientes 
 Análisis de requisitos: extraer los requisitos del producto, los clientes piensa 
deben de saber qué hace el software, esta es la primera etapa para crearlo, se 
requieren de habilidades y experiencia en la ingeniería de software para 
reconocer requisitos incompletos y ambiguos 
 Especificación: la especificación de requerimientos describe el comportamiento 
esperado del software, entre las técnicas más usadas para la especificación de 
requerimientos se encuentran 
 programación: se estable el código del software, con diseño previamente 
hecho, la complejidad de esta técnica está relacionada con los lenguajes de 
programa ya que estos tienen cierto grado de complejidad 
 prueba: consiste en comprobar que el software realice correctamente las tareas 
indicadas en la especificación del problema, la técnica de prueba es probar por 
separado cada módulo del software 
 documentación: toda la documentación del propio desarrollo del software y de 
la gestión del proyecto, pasando por modelaciones UML 
 
 
 
 Caso de usos 
 
 Historia de usuario 
 
 Arquitectura: se define la integración de las infraestructura, desarrollo de 
aplicaciones, base de datos y herramientas gerenciales 
 Cada proyecto necesita una documentación basada en diagramas 
 
 
 
 
 
 
 
 
 Diagramas de clase 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 Diagrama de base de datos 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 Diagrama de actividades 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 diagramas de secuencia 
 
 
 
 
 
 
 
 mantenimiento: mantener y mejorar el software para enfrentar errores 
descubiertos y nuevos requisitos, esto tiene un tiempo determinado, un 
mantenimiento puede llevar más tiempo hasta en el desarrollo inicial del 
software. 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
EJERCICIOS/ACTIVIDADES 
1. Realizar un foro virtual sobre la seguridad, auditoria y el control del sistema 
 
 
 
BIBLIOGRAFIA 
 
1. Norton, P. (2006). Introducción a la computación. México DF: McGraw-Hill 
Interamericana 
 
2. Informática Hoy. (2012). Informática, tecnología e Internet sin complicaciones. 
Obtenido de 
Qué sistemas de información: http://www.informatica-
hoy.com.ar/aprenderinformatica/Que-es-sistemas-de-informacion.php. 
 
 
3. (cioal, 2015). Era de la computación ahora más convenientes, divertida y sin cable 
http://www.cioal.com/2015/05/08/7-nuevas-tecnologias-hardware-windows-10/ 
 
 
4. VICENTE FERNANDEZ (2010). Desarrollo de sistemas de información: una 
metodología basada en el ode lado 
https://pdfs.semanticscholar.org/946d/1e19f09e8dac8744f7875c876fe14a73e9b0.pd 
 
 
 
http://www.informatica-hoy.com.ar/aprenderinformatica/Que-es-sistemas-de-informacion.php
http://www.informatica-hoy.com.ar/aprenderinformatica/Que-es-sistemas-de-informacion.php
http://www.cioal.com/2015/05/08/7-nuevas-tecnologias-hardware-windows-10/

Continuar navegando